LOWRY v. GEN. WATERWORKS CORP.


406 Pa. 152 (1962)

Lowry, Appellant, v. General Waterworks Corporation.

Supreme Court of Pennsylvania.

January 2, 1962.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

W. Bradley Ward, with him John A. Eichman, 3rd, and Clark, Spahr, Eichman & Yardley, and Schnader, Harrison, Segal & Lewis, for appellants.

Richard C. Bull, with him LeRoy E. Perper, and White and Williams, for appellee.

Before BELL, C.J., JONES, COHEN, EAGEN and ALPERN, JJ.


OPINION BY MR. JUSTICE BENJAMIN R. JONES, January 2, 1962:

On April 12, 1957 a majority of the directors of Fifteen Hundred Walnut Street Corporation (Fifteen Hundred), a Pennsylvania corporation, approved a plan and agreement of merger with General Waterworks Corporation (General), a Delaware corporation. On June 3, 1957 at a stockholders' meeting this merger became effective over the dissenting votes of appellants.
